A FLEET IN MUTINY.

PORTUGUESE WARSHIPS UNDER GUNS OF __RTS.

United Press Association—By Electric Telegraph—Copyright. LISBON, April 19. Fire Portugese warships are anchored in the river Tagus, under the guns of the forts. Fourteen hundred seamem are confined in the barracks. It is alleged that undue severity an the part of the commander of the Dom Carlos caused the mutiny.
